What you’ll be doing Serve as the first point of contact within the Customer Service team for all customer queries, both pre-travel and in-resort. Liaise with customers regarding amendments to their holiday bookings and handle any additional requirements, upselling where appropriate and going the extra mile to enhance their experience. Support customers throughout the online booking journey by assisting with operator-confirmed bookings, resolving issues such as pricing discrepancies or unavailable dates, and guiding them through next steps to ensure a smooth, stress-free process. Ensure all communications comply with Data Protection regulations and all payments are PCI compliant. Accurately book flights, hotels, transfers and extras, ensuring all documents and correspondence fully reflect any changes or added requirements.
